Margie McEvers Hagan, 1926-2020

Posted in:
  • Article Image Alt Text

Margie McEvers Hagan, 94, passed away Thursday afternoon December 3, 2020 in Liberty, Texas. She was born March 16, 1926 in Abbeville, Louisiana to Edgar McEvers and Mildred Vanslyke McEvers.

In 1946, Margie graduated as a Registered Nurse from the New Orleans Hotel Dieu School of Nursing, after graduating high school with honors at age16. Her accelerated education was to help the nursing shortage during WWII. Margie and her family moved to Liberty in 1963 where she became an active member of Immaculate Conception Catholic Church. She worked as the Supervisor of the Operating room and later as the Director of Nurses at Yettie Kersting Memorial Hospital until she retired at age 65. Because of Margie’s love for nursing, she went back to work as an RN at The Hallmark retirement community in Houston. After her second retirement at age 73, she moved back to Liberty to her beloved hometown.

Margie was preceded in death by her husband Richard Hagan and her twin sons Richard and Charles Hagan. She is survived by her son Patrick Hagan (Robin), grandchildren Sean Hagan (Tiffany), Kathleen Flowers (Johnny), Chris Hagan (Amy), Russell Hagan (Lesley) and Kathryn Ploetzner (Jamie) and her great grandchildren Amanda Dossey, Addison Hagan, Jarrett Hagan, Hayley Hagan and Emery Ploetzner. Her best friend Mary Etta Clemonds and her niece Cathy Meaux were also a very cherished part of her life.

“When you save a life you are a hero, when you save a hundred you are a nurse”.
